文章目录Dockerfile简介Docker制作jdk镜像 Dockerfile简介Dockerfile 是一个文本格式的配置文件 用户可以使用 Dockerfile 来快速创建自定义的镜像 另外 使用Dockerfile去构建镜像好比使用pom去构建maven项目一样 有异曲同工之妙Dockerfile基本结构Dockerfile 由一行行命令语句组成 并且支持以#开头的注释行 一般而言 Do
转载 2月前
88阅读
# Docker部署Jar指定配置文件启动教程 ## 概述 本教程旨在指导刚入行的开发者实现使用Docker部署Jar包并指定配置文件启动的步骤。Docker是一种容器化技术,可以将应用程序及其依赖项打包成一个独立的容器,方便部署和管理。 ## 整体流程 下面是实现"docker部署jar指定配置文件启动"的整体流程: | 步骤 | 描述 | | ---- | ---- | | 1
原创 2023-08-15 09:32:03
986阅读
. 一、探究常规 Springboot 如何编译 Docker 镜像. 1、准备编译镜像的 SpringBoot 项目. 2、准备 Dockerfile 文件. 3、构建 Docker 镜像. 4、将镜像推送到镜像仓库. 5、拉取镜像. 6、修改 Java 源码重新打包 Jar 后再次尝试. 7、使用镜像过程中的感受. 二、了解 Docker 分层及缓存机制. 1、Docker 分层缓存简介. 2
目的: 将原本可以通过如下命令//运行client.jar 包中的 io.grpc.examples.helloworld.HelloWorldServer 的主函数,并且要依赖同级目录libs下的jar包 java -Djava.ext.dirs=libs -cp client.jar io.grpc.examples.helloworld.HelloWorldServer运行的java
转载 2月前
27阅读
# Docker中使用Jar指定配置文件的方法 在将应用程序打包成Jar包并部署Docker容器中时,有时候需要根据不同的环境加载不同的配置文件,例如开发环境、测试环境和生产环境。这篇文章将介绍如何使用Docker指定Jar包的配置文件。 ## 准备工作 首先,我们需要准备一个Spring Boot应用程序,并且将它打包成Jar包。可以使用Maven作为构建工具,在pom.xml文件中添
原创 7月前
152阅读
# 如何在Docker中启动一个jar指定配置文件 ## 引言 作为一名经验丰富的开发者,你可能经常需要使用Docker部署应用程序。在实际开发中,有时候需要启动一个jar指定配置文件,这对于刚入行的小白可能会有些困惑。在本文中,我将向你详细介绍如何在Docker中启动一个jar指定配置文件的步骤和代码示例。 ## 流程图 ```mermaid flowchart TD A(拉
原创 6月前
189阅读
## Docker运行jar指定配置文件 在实际开发中,我们经常会遇到需要将Java应用程序打包成jar包并运行的情况。而在部署过程中,有时候我们需要根据不同的环境(开发、测试、生产等)使用不同的配置文件。那么如何在通过Docker运行jar包时指定配置文件呢?接下来我们将介绍如何实现这一功能。 ### 1. 创建一个简单的Java应用程序 首先,我们创建一个简单的Java应用程序,示例代
## 实现“entrypoint docker 指定配置文件启动jar” ### 1. 流程图 ```mermaid gantt title Docker启动jar流程图 section 整体流程 克隆代码 :done, des1, 2022-01-01, 1d 配置Dockerfile :done,
原创 4月前
142阅读
# 使用 Docker 启动 JAR 并动态指定配置文件的实用指南 在开发与部署微服务时,使用 Docker 容器化应用是常见的做法。对于 Java 应用,通常是以 JAR 包的形式存在。在这篇指南中,我们将学习如何使用 Docker 启动 JAR 文件,并动态指定配置文件。为了帮助理解,我将提供清晰的步骤和代码示例。 ## 流程概述 以下是实现的步骤概述: | 步骤 | 描述 | |-
原创 20天前
19阅读
# 如何使用 Docker 部署 Spring Boot 指定配置文件 在这篇文章中,我将教你如何利用 Docker 部署一个 Spring Boot 应用,并在部署指定特定的配置文件。我们将通过一个明确的流程和步骤来完成这一任务。 ## 流程概述 首先,让我们看一下整个部署过程的流程,具体步骤如表格所示: | 步骤 | 说明 | |-----
原创 29天前
47阅读
# Docker部署Jar包动态配置文件 ## 1. 简介 Docker是一种容器化技术,可以帮助我们快速部署和运行应用程序。在开发过程中,我们经常需要将我们的应用程序打包成一个可执行的Jar包,并且希望动态加载配置文件。本文将介绍如何使用Docker部署Jar包,并在部署过程中动态加载配置文件。 ## 2. Docker部署Jar包流程 下面是使用Docker部署Jar包并动态加载配置文件
原创 10月前
114阅读
Docker自从诞生以来就一直备受追捧,学习Docker是一件很炫酷、很有意思的事情。我希望通过这篇文章能够让大家快速地入门Docker,并有一些学习成果来激发自己的学习兴趣。我也只是一个在Docker这条巨鲸上玩耍的小孩,全文如有不明确、不正确的地方,还请斧正。Docker简介思想集装箱标准化运输方式存储方式API接口隔离Docker镜像所谓镜像就是程序运行的环境的只读版本。其包含了所有程序的依
# 如何实现“docker启动本地镜像指定配置文件” ## 操作流程 以下是实现“docker启动本地镜像指定配置文件”的步骤: | 步骤 | 操作 | | --- | --- | | 1 | 构建Docker镜像 | | 2 | 创建配置文件 | | 3 | 启动Docker容器并指定配置文件 | ## 具体操作步骤 ### 步骤1:构建Docker镜像 首先,你需要构建一个Dock
原创 2月前
46阅读
# 使用Docker挂载JAR包并指定配置文件的完整流程 在现代软件开发中,Docker技术因其优秀的隔离性和便捷取代传统的虚拟机成为了主流选择。今天,我们将学习如何使用Docker挂载一个JAR包,并为其指定一个特定的配置文件。本文将通过简单易懂的步骤帮助你完成这个任务。 ## 整体流程 在开始之前,我们先概览一下整个流程: | 步骤 | 描述
原创 26天前
14阅读
# Docker部署Redis并指定配置文件位置 在现代应用中,Redis作为高性能的Key-Value存储系统,广泛应用于缓存和数据存储。在Docker的帮助下,我们可以轻松地部署Redis并指定配置文件的位置。本文将介绍如何通过Docker部署Redis,并在部署过程中使用自定义的Redis配置文件。 ## Redis配置文件 Redis的配置文件通常是一个文本文件,包含了Redis服
原创 19天前
11阅读
# Docker启动Jar服务指定外部配置文件 在使用Docker部署Java应用时,通常会将应用打包为可执行的Jar文件,并且需要指定外部配置文件,以便在不同环境中灵活配置应用参数。本文将介绍如何使用Docker启动Jar服务并指定外部配置文件。 ## 准备工作 在开始之前,确保已经安装了Docker和Java环境。另外,需要准备一个Java应用的可执行Jar文件和外部配置文件。 ##
原创 4月前
168阅读
## Dockerfile指定jar配置文件 在使用Docker构建镜像时,我们经常需要指定运行容器所需的jar文件配置文件。Dockerfile是用于构建Docker镜像的文本文件,可以通过在其中指定jar配置文件来实现容器的运行。 ### Dockerfile基本结构 一个典型的Dockerfile通常包含以下几个部分: 1. 基础镜像声明:指定用于构建当前镜像的基础镜像。 2.
原创 7月前
170阅读
# Java中使用Jar文件指定配置文件的方法 在Java开发中,我们经常需要使用配置文件来保存一些应用程序的参数或者设置。而在将应用程序打包成Jar文件后,我们可能需要在不解压或修改Jar文件的情况下,动态地加载指定配置文件。这篇文章将介绍如何在Java中使用Jar文件指定配置文件的方法。 ## 1. 理解Jar文件 首先,我们需要理解什么是Jar文件Jar文件是Java Archiv
原创 10月前
1325阅读
# 使用Dockerfile指定配置文件 在使用Docker容器部署Java应用程序时,经常需要指定一些配置文件配置应用程序的运行环境。在这种情况下,我们可以通过Dockerfile来指定要添加到容器中的配置文件,以便在容器启动时使用。 ## 创建Dockerfile 首先,我们需要创建一个Dockerfile来构建我们的Java应用程序的Docker镜像,并在其中指定要添加的配置文件
# 如何在Java中指定配置文件 作为一名经验丰富的开发者,我可以帮助你解决在Java中指定配置文件的问题。在本文中,我将向你展示整个过程,并为每一步提供详细的代码和解释。 ## 流程图 ```mermaid flowchart TD A[加载配置文件] --> B[读取配置文件] B --> C[使用配置文件中的参数] ``` ## 步骤 下面是实现"Java jar
原创 8月前
137阅读
  • 1
  • 2
  • 3
  • 4
  • 5